Most-quoted passages

The sentences later courts lift from this opinion, ranked by how many decisions quote each — the parts of the opinion doing the work. These counts are smaller than the citation total above because most of the 5 citing decisions cite the case generally; a passage count includes only decisions quoting that exact language verbatim.

  1. “Although the evidence was conflicting, there was competent evidence to support the trial court’s finding that the defendant knowingly and voluntarily consented to the search. We have previously held that under such circumstances considerable weight must be given to the trial court’s finding and that this Court will not reverse where the ruling is based upon competent evidence reasonably tending to support the finding. (Citations omitted)”
    1 later decision quote this exact passage
  2. “burden of proof is on the State to prove by clear and convincing evidence that the consent to search was free[ly] and voluntarily given”
    1 later decision quote this exact passage
